View Top Employees for Optimum Fleet
img Website optimumfleet.co.uk
img Industry Facilities Services
img Location Manchester, Manchester, United Kingdom
img Employees 3
img Founded 2007
img Website optimumfleet.co.uk
img Industry Facilities Services
img Location Manchester, Manchester, United Kingdom
img Employees 3
img Founded 2007
img LinkedIn linkedin.com/company/optimum-fleet

Top Optimum Fleet Employees